    Afghan Captain Criticizes Greater Noida Stadium Ahead of Historic Test Match

    India has shown strong support for the Afghanistan cricket team by designating three venues for their upcoming matches: Greater Noida, Kanpur, and Lucknow. Among these, the Shaheed Vijay Singh Pathik Sports Complex in Greater Noida is set to host a historic Test match between Afghanistan and New Zealand starting September 9. This will mark the first-ever Test encounter between the two teams. However, recent comments by Afghan captain Hasmatullah Shahidi have brought attention to some issues at the Greater Noida stadium.

    Captain’s Critique Amid Heavy Rainfall

    The Afghanistan team arrived in India on August 28 to prepare for this landmark Test series. Unfortunately, heavy rains in the Delhi NCR region have caused significant waterlogging issues on the practice pitches. The lack of proper facilities, such as super-soppers or pitch covers, has hindered the team’s preparation.

    Captain Hasmatullah Shahidi voiced his frustration in a recent statement reported by the Indian Express. He humorously remarked that the conditions at the stadium made it more suitable for swimming rather than cricket. Shahidi said, “We should have brought our own swim gear. We will not be able to play here in any way. This is a good place to swim. Sir, we are used to it, but what will you answer to the New Zealanders?” His comments highlight the challenging conditions the Afghan team is facing as they prepare for their historic Test match.

    A Crucial Match for Both Teams

    The upcoming Test match holds significant importance for both Afghanistan and New Zealand. Afghanistan has announced a preliminary squad of 20 players, from which 15 will be selected for the final match. The selection will follow a week of fitness and training sessions to ensure the team is in top condition despite the adverse weather conditions.

    New Zealand is scheduled to arrive in India next week, preparing not only for this Test match but also for a series against India in October. For New Zealand, this match serves as crucial preparation, adding to the significance of the game.
